Hechos clave:
-
Un desarrollador se puso como meta dar 500 golpes diarios al saco de boxeo, o perder 100 ETH.
-
Un tarjeta de conexión a redes blockchain le avisa cuando cumple la meta.
El desarrollador egipcio Amr Saleh diseñó un sistema novedoso para motivarse a avanzar y completar su entrenamiento deportivo, utilizando su saco de boxeo, un contrato inteligente de Ethereum y una tarjeta de desarrollo para crear proyectos de hardware, que se interconecta con redes blockchain.
En un escrito publicado en Medium este 29 de mayo, Saleh explicó el proceso. En primer lugar, procedió a codificar un contrato inteligente en el cual estableció las pautas del entrenamiento. Allà colocó 100 ethers (ETH) y se puso como meta dar al saco unos 500 golpes diarios. Las cláusulas estipulan que en caso de cumplir esta meta recuperará el dinero, de lo contrario, los ethers irán a la caridad.
De esta forma, aprovechó la propiedad de los contratos inteligentes para liberar los fondos una vez se cumplen los requisitos preestablecidos. En este caso, el desarrollador recupera los fondos depositados en ETH si lanza suficientes puñetazos. Si no completa la rutina de entrenamiento, el contrato enviará las criptomonedas a una cartera elegida para entregar los fondos a donación.
Para medir el cumplimiento de la meta diaria, usó una placa de desarrollo de blockchain que fue diseñada por él, junto a Eslam Ali y Amr e Islam Mustafa, todos cofundadores de la startup egipcia Elk. Saleh acota que la tarjeta ejecuta el cliente Go Ethereum en su modo de luz, permitiendo registrar datos de sensores en contratos inteligentes fácilmente.
Al conectar Elk a un acelerómetro pude contar el número de golpes / patadas, y puse una bombilla en la parte superior del saco de boxeo que parpadea si el puño cuenta. Y para saber cuándo terminé el dÃa, una vez que alcancé los 500 golpes, la placa parpadearÃa cinco veces para mÃ.
Amr Saleh
El desarrollador recuerda que la tarjeta -que se lanzará en junio próximo- busca facilitar las conexiones del Internet de las cosas (IoT) con la tecnologÃa blockchain. También será posible desarrollar proyectos de hardware para el envÃo de pagos en BTC, ETH, DAI o cualquier token ERC20. Asimismo expresa que con este experimento, no solo sacó provecho de la tecnologÃa y avanzó en su plan de ejercicios, sino que utilizó una regla que aplica a la mayorÃa de los inversionistas, la cual tiene que ver con la aversión a la pérdida económica.